Oceanside Beaches
Soak up the rays! Oceanside offers a vast shoreline for tanning and building sandcastles. During the summertime, it's quite pleasant for swimming and other water sports. Surfers will find a home at this beach as well, with the summer surf averaging four to seven feet. Surfing is restricted during the summer months to certain areas. During the evening, utilize one of the campfire sites available on the beach to toast marshmallows. Picnic tables and barbecue areas are available.

Spanning 1,942 feet, Oceanside Municipal Pier is one of the most notable piers in the Western United States. Not only is it the longest wooden pier along the West Coast, but this spot also holds the title as the longest over-water pier at 1,954 feet (596m) in Southern California. Unlike many ports, all boats are visible from a two-lane asphalt drive encircling its shoreline. Restaurants, picnic tables and a Harbor Village with shops, eateries and a lighthouse along the nearby Harbor Beach create an enchanting experience and atmosphere. In Oceanside, the Harbor is a mecca for sportfishing, boating, whale watching and other water-oriented activities.

Buena Vista Audobon Society's Nature Center
Visit a coastal wetlands habitat at the Buena Vista Audobon Society's Nature Center. A number of classes, story time groups, guides and outreach programs are offered weekly.

Luiseno Park
Douglas Drive and Vandergrift Boulevard
I-5 to Mission Avenue, east on Mission to Douglas Drive, north on Douglas. Park site is located on the southwest corner of Douglas Drive and Vandegrift Boulevard
Size: 10 acres
Amenities: 2 Multi-purpose Fields, Drinking Fountain, Two Play Structures, Parking Area, Restrooms, Tennis Courts

September 19 and 20th, 2009 - The Oceanside Chamber of Commerce along with Cox Communications and Genentech, will present Oceanside Harbor Days at the Oceanside Harbor. The event will feature arts and craft exhibits, Pirate's Cove area, children's area, Nail n' Sail Competition, Military, Police & Fire displays, great food and fun activities. The event is open from 9:00am to 6:00pm each day. Harbor Days is free to the public.

This historical mission was once the largest building in California and now home to 14 monks.
Oceanside is home to the Mission San Luis Rey de Francia, one of the Alta California missions. Named in honor of St Louis, King of France, is located in a secluded valley four miles east of Highway 5 in Oceanside. Founded in June 1798 by Father Fermin Francisco de Lasuen, the Mission is one of the most architecturally impressive of all the California missions.

Located adjacent to the beginning of the Oceanside pier is the Oceanside Amphitheater which plays a host to various events through the year like the Summer Jame Talent Show and other musical performances. When not booked for an event, many Oceanside residents use it to relax or even exercise!

Guajome Regional Park, once part of Mission San Luis Rey, covers 579 acres, including a 25-acre lake. The lake does not have a launch ramp, but is ideal for children to attempt their first shore fishing endeavor. In addition to the lake, this park also features a large children's play area as well as various hiking trails.
